Since the 1980s, volunteers have monitored and recorded nesting activity in New Smyrna Beach under a government permit. Volunteers from various backgrounds joined forces in an effort to protect nesting sea turtles, their eggs, and hatchlings from beach driving and other human induced threats.

In 2013, the volunteer group reorganized as the New Smyrna Beach Marine Turtle Conservancy. With the help of Jessi Bruton, a graphic designer with New Smyrna Beach roots, the NSB Turtle Trackers brand was developed as the official name for the volunteers of the New Smyrna Beach Marine Turtle Conservancy.

While the name of our group has changed, our goals have not. We are still committed to the tracking and conservation of threatened and endangered sea turtles and public education in New Smyrna Beach.
